    Directions:

    1. 1
      In bowl, add ingredients in the above order , mixing well after each addition (you can do it in a processor too).
    2. 2
      Using half of the dough roll on a floured board to 1/8" and cut into holiday shapes-dreidel, star.
    3. 3
      Can decorate with chocolate chip, raisin, sprinkles, colored sugar, etc.
    4. 4
      Bake at 325 degrees Fahrenheit for 10 minutes or so till lightly browned. They firm up a bit more as they cool.
    5. 5
      Freeze well, but they won't last that long.
    6. 6
      NOTE: If making different shapes, try and make all of one shape on a tray because the different sizes don't bake at the same rate; some will burn and others will be under baked.
